Artist Statement

I am essentially arranging things. People arrange things all the time, sometimes consciously and sometimes absentmindedly. Most art practices involve arranging things in space, time, or both, but mine is centered on this activity. My things are arranged utilizing an acute visual sensitivity developed over years of formal artistic training, and extensive professional experience involving the organization of interior residential spaces. Over time I have observed arrangements based on various considerations. These have ranged from practical reasons like the most efficient use of space to purely aesthetic reasons, like the most visually pleasing configuration of things. My art production takes special consideration for the way that non-arrangement-specialists, or civilians, handle the placement of things in their daily lives.

This is more than just a starting point for me but not quite an end in itself, especially considering all of the political and social implications that arrangements can entail.
